The International Württemberg Women's Tennis Championships at the Stuttgart City Cup 2014 was a men's tennis tournament of ITF in Vaihingen , a municipality of Stuttgart . The clay court tournament was part of the ITF Women's Circuit 2014 and took place from June 23-29, 2014.
